Home Weatherization: Benefits

You should look into home weatherization if you want to improve your cooling and heating efficiency. Home weatherization is a cost-saving method that can also be beneficial for the environment and your finances. Weatherization will make your house healthier for you and family. It will increase indoor air quality as well as protect your home from external allergens. This is especially beneficial for people with allergies and other chronic conditions. This will help you save money each month on your electric bills.

The many benefits of home weatherization have been widely acknowledged. The residential sector accounts for nearly one-fifth in energy consumption in the U.S. There is a lot of literature available on the energy savings that homeowners can expect from weatherization. The U.S. Department of Energy recently reported that simple home weatherization measures can help homeowners save as much as 30% on their energy bills.

In addition, homeowners can benefit from energy-saving features. Research has shown weatherization can help reduce the risk of asthmatic hospitalizations and air contaminants. You will also enjoy better indoor air quality. Improvements in indoor air quality are possible by sealing cracks or air leaks. This is especially important to those with asthma or other respiratory conditions. Additionally, energy-efficient properties can help save the earth by reducing energy costs.

Kansas City Weatherization Program

Weatherization Assistance Programs (WAP) provide low-cost, energy efficient home improvements to income-eligible families. The program's goal is to lower your energy bills while increasing comfort and safety within your home. You must have a household with a minimum income and a large enough household to be eligible for Home Weatherization. Low income people can receive energy audits and energy saving measures for no cost. You can also receive weatherization services for those who have children or households with low income.

The state's median income is 60 percent. This means that only those households have the ability to apply for weatherization assistance. If you rent, your landlord must give you written permission before you begin the weatherization process. Although income is not the only factor that determines your eligibility for weatherization services, it can have a significant impact on how much you save over the long-term. Kansas City Free Weatherization Program

You can save a lot of money on your gas and electricity bills by weatherizing your home. A home weatherization project will cost you several thousand dollars. However, you will be able save money for a long time. You'll quickly see the savings and pay back your initial investment. The best part is that you will increase the home's worth by several thousand. Weatherizing your home will actually save you on average $300 each year and could even increase the home's worth.


Even if it isn't possible to pay a professional to install weather-stripping, you can do it yourself with inexpensive products from home improvement stores. You can prevent heated air escaping by using caulk. You can use this product in any room of your house, including the basement and attic. You may need to buy Mortite or foam board depending on how large the gaps are.
